Serial number 91450 for 1967.
The 32 3/8 inch blade good but with inert rust patches, mostly towards the point, firm in hilt. Hilt / guard good / sound but with tarnish and rust speckles, mostly inside the bowl guard. Grip and associated grip wire bindings in good condition. The leather field service scabbard is good overall but the frog suspension loop is aged / cracking. The sword sheathes and draws well.
